  • 1OnSong projects only song lyrics to a TV/projector (sing-along) — no requests or photos.
  • 2OnSong only tracks which songs were played at a venue (to avoid repeats) — not a full venue archive.
  • 3OnSong has automatic chord recognition, not AI editing.
  • 4OnSong shares over the local network (Beam) / a shared drive on the Groups plan — not a continuous cloud-synced band library.
  • 5SongBook Pro syncs your own library across your own devices (file sync) — not a shared, live-edited band workspace.

Honest differences

Where the others do things differently.

No app is the right fit for everyone. Here's where OnSong and SongBook Pro take a different path — so you can choose with your eyes open.

Feature Strofa OnSong SongBook Pro
Native platforms iPhone / iPad (+ Mac as an iPad app on Apple Silicon) iPhone / iPad / Mac (native) iOS / Android / Mac / Windows (widest)
Pricing Subscription Subscription One-time purchase (+ optional cloud sync)

Competitor features are verified against their official documentation (July 2026) and may change. ~ = partial or different approach.
